We are excited to announce that Los Angeles Harbor College is ONE of the newest MESA programs in our LACCD.  A grassroots effort that began in 1970 with 25 students at Oakland Technical High School in 1970 has flourished into an award-winning program that serves over 25,000 middle school, high school, community college, and university level students throughout California each year. 

The Los Angeles Harbor College MESA programs goals include:

1. Increase the number and percentage of underrepresented and/or low-income students attaining certificates and degrees in Science, Technology, Engineering and Math (STEM);

2. Empower and support educationally disadvantaged, first-generation community college students pursuing STEM degrees while providing academic, financial, and professional development resources; and

3. Increase the number and percentage of underrepresented and/or low-income students transferring to baccalaureate programs in STEM.

MESA Eligibility Requirements At a Glance

The MESA Program aims to help students achieve success in math-and-science based degrees.  Through MESA, students develop academic and leadership skills, increase educational performance, and gain confidence in their ability to compete professionally.  You can join a cohort of students on a similar path to you for support and motivation.  This community of learners, with a very specialized focus, is what sets MESA apart from other student success programs.  

The following requirement is needed to be eligible for MESA:

  1. Calculus-based major

The additional criteria below are highly recommended but not needed to join MESA:

  1. Educationally underserved
  2. Proof of financial need
  3. Fist-generation college student
  4. Intend to transfer to a 4-year institution as a calculus-based STEM major.
